MY WORLD, World Bird Wednesday - Sacred Ibis


What you can find in a major metropolis . . . Australian White
or Sacred Ibis, Treskiornis molucca, perfectly adapted to the
urban environment thrive as scavengers from rubbish bins with
their long beaks ideal for sorting through the leftovers and
aerating the lawns of sports-fields as a sideline.
